Introducing Rent Ready! Know more and stress less

January 16, 2025


The City of Edmonton is helping renters find and keep housing through free courses on tenant rights and responsibilities, budgeting, home maintenance and navigating the application process. Rent Ready courses, offered in partnership with Bissell Centre, C5 Hub and the Edmonton Public Library, are part of the City's efforts to prevent homelessness by empowering tenants.


“Through the Rent Ready courses, we are equipping renters with the essential knowledge and skills needed to secure and maintain housing. By empowering tenants with this information, we are taking proactive steps to prevent homelessness and ensure housing stability for all,” said Hani Quan, Director, Affordable Housing and Homelessness.


Renting can be complicated. To make it easier, these courses teach people about the rights and responsibilities of tenants and landlords, ways to find savings and make the most of their money, creating a safe home, communicating effectively with landlords and applying to rent.


Two types of courses are offered:

  • Basic Course: a three hour in-person course that gives renters the knowledge and tools they need to find housing that works for them. 
  • Certificate Course: a more in-depth four week in-person course. Upon completion, participants will receive a certificate recognized by The Alberta Residential Landlord Association as a reference for rental applications.

More than one-third of Edmonton households rent. The City and its partners want to empower people to become great tenants so they can find and keep their housing. 


The free Rent Ready courses are part of the City’s efforts to prevent homelessness and housing insecurity and create an inclusive Edmonton for all of us. Everyone deserves safe, stable and adequate housing.
